Originally Posted by FlywithUS
I know the new callsign for the merged carrier will be Cactus, does that mean that all flights will be branded HPxxxx instead of USxxxx
I'd imagine it depends upon which certificate "survives". Maybe. FWIW, the certificate for the combined carrier will be managed by the PIT FAA office.

I'm not up on Part 121 certificate ins and outs. I suppose they could keep HP, but that would seem a bit strange on monitors and such in Europe for an airline named "US Airways."

And before anyone brings up the "yeah, but they are keeping Cactus" thing, the general public (save on United) does not generally encounter ATC communications. Whereas they do see flight numbers on BPs, airport monitors, and the like.
